How Scroll Effects and Animations Elevate Modern Web Design and User Experience
Scroll effects and animations have evolved far beyond mere decorative elements in web design. Today, they play a pivotal role in creating a lively, intuitive, and modern website experience. In a digital age where attention is a limited resource, targeted effects and movements can make all the difference, capturing users' attention, simplifying navigation, and supporting the comprehension of complex content. Take advantage of a web design agency to make your project in this field more efficient.
Consider this: 88% of users judge websites based on visual design and usability. This statistic underscores that modern users not only value easy access to information but also expect a visually engaging and functional experience. Scroll effects that enhance storytelling and animations that make interactions more intuitive are essential tools for keeping users engaged and making content more impactful.
In this article, we'll explore how various types of scroll effects and animations can elevate your website's user experience. From parallax scrolling to micro-interactions, these elements offer powerful ways to create emotional engagement and deliver information in a meaningful way. If you need support in this field, you'll find the best UX design agency right on our platform.
An experienced web design agency can provide you with the best advice in this regard.
- 1. Why Scroll Effects and Animations Matter in Web Design
- 1.1 Psychological Impact of Movement
- 1.2 Enhancing Brand Identity
- 1.3 Improving Usability
- 1.4 Boosting Conversion Rates
- 2. Types of Scroll Effects
- 2.1 Parallax Scrolling
- 2.2 Reveal Effects
- 2.3 Infinite Scrolling
- 2.4 Lazy Loading
- 3. Motion Animations: Strategies and Examples
- 3.1 Micro-Interactions
- 3.2 Hover Effects
- 3.3 Loading Animations
- 3.4 Transition Animations
- 4. Best Practices for Using Scroll Effects and Animations
- 4.1 User-Centric Design: Matching Effects to Content
- 4.2 Performance Optimization: Efficiently Designed Effects
- 4.3 Mobile Compatibility: Adapting to Different Devices
- 4.4 Minimal Use: Striking the Right Balance
- 5. Tools and Technologies for Scroll Effects and Animations
- 5.1 JavaScript Libraries: Flexibility and Control
- 5.2 No-Code Tools: Animation Without Coding Knowledge
- 5.3 CSS Animations: Simple and Performant
- 6. Conclusion: The Value of Scroll Effects and Animations in Modern Web Design
Why Scroll Effects and Animations Matter in Web Design
Scroll effects and animations are not just aesthetic flourishes; theyβre essential tools for enhancing the user experience. Targeted animations and movement direct usersβ attention, making it easier to understand content and stay engaged with the site. At a time when usersβ attention spans are shorter than ever, visual support plays a vital role in conveying information effectively and keeping users on the page.
Psychological Impact of Movement
Movement has a strong psychological impact on users. Animated elements stand out and draw focus, which can be useful for emphasizing important content. By combining movement with visual design, users feel more engaged and are more likely to stay on the site. Animated effects leverage our natural inclination toward motion to help guide user attention in a purposeful way.
Enhancing Brand Identity
Scroll effects and animations can also reinforce brand identity. Websites that incorporate unique visual elements are more memorable and distinct from competitors. By incorporating characteristic animations or motion patterns, brands create a customized experience that builds recognition and trust with users, leaving a lasting impression. If your project is in this field, incorporating a branding agency provides invaluable value for a targeted implementation.
Improving Usability
Well-implemented animations significantly improve a websiteβs usability. Animations can indicate where interactive elements are located or how to navigate content, making the interface more intuitive. Visual cues guide users, helping them quickly understand the siteβs layout and structure. For example, a subtle animation might make transitions between sections more comprehensible, especially on mobile devices, where small screens can complicate navigation.
Boosting Conversion Rates
Scroll effects and animations can also directly impact conversions. By drawing attention to key areas, animations can encourage users to take specific actions β whether itβs clicking a button, completing a purchase, or sharing content. Effects that highlight important areas can increase engagement and lead to higher conversion rates. For instance, a subtly animated βBuy Nowβ button or a special offer that appears while scrolling can create appeal and prompt user interaction.
Types of Scroll Effects
Scroll effects offer a variety of ways to enhance the user experience on websites. From subtle movements to dynamic transitions, choosing the right effect and applying it effectively can make a design feel more engaging and intuitive. Below are some of the most popular types of scroll effects and where they work best.
Parallax Scrolling
Parallax scrolling is one of the most popular effects in modern web design. In parallax scrolling, different layers of a website move at different speeds, creating a sense of three-dimensional depth and giving the page a dynamic feel. This technique is especially effective for storytelling websites that want to present content in a specific sequence. For example, travel websites use parallax scrolling to create an immersive experience, allowing users to feel like theyβre βdiving intoβ the images.
Benefits of Parallax Scrolling:
Enhances visual appeal and leaves a memorable impression.
Boosts engagement as users scroll further to experience the full effect.
Ideal for content that tells a story or needs to be viewed in a specific order.
Reveal Effects
Reveal effects make content visible only when the user scrolls to a particular point on the page, adding an element of suspense and guiding users through the content step-by-step. Reveal effects are especially effective for content-focused pages that need to emphasize individual sections and present information in a controlled sequence. This effect increases focus and ensures that each section remains in the spotlight as users scroll.
Benefits of Reveal Effects:
Directs attention to specific content.
Supports the step-by-step presentation of information, aiding comprehension.
Perfect for interactive storytelling or step-by-step guides.
Infinite Scrolling
Infinite scrolling, where content continuously loads as the user scrolls, is commonly found on social media platforms and e-commerce websites. This effect provides a seamless experience by simplifying navigation and keeping users engaged. However, it also has drawbacks, as it can be challenging to locate the endpoint or re-find content. If you're considering starting a project in this field, an E-Commerce development company can provide the expertise and support you need.
Pros and Cons of Infinite Scrolling:
Pros: Smooth navigation and high usability, especially for frequently updated content.
Cons: Can lead to user fatigue and is less suitable for highly structured content.
Lazy Loading
Lazy loading delays the loading of content and images until they are in the visible area, optimizing load times by only loading what the user needs. This is particularly useful for image-heavy websites and pages with long content, as it reduces data consumption and improves performance on mobile devices.
Benefits of Lazy Loading:
Improves load time and enhances usability.
Reduces data usage and improves mobile performance.
Especially valuable for image-heavy content or lengthy articles.
Motion Animations: Strategies and Examples
In addition to scroll effects, motion animations are crucial for modern web design. They bring the user interface to life, making interactions more intuitive and clarifying information. From subtle micro-interactions to more prominent transitions, motion animations vary widely in purpose and impact.
Micro-Interactions
Micro-interactions are small, targeted animations that respond to user actions like clicking, tapping, or scrolling. These subtle movements provide visual feedback and increase interactivity. Micro-interactions are often used for buttons, icons, or form fields to confirm actions and enhance usability. For instance, a button might change color when clicked, indicating that the action has been registered.
Benefits of Micro-Interactions:
Provide immediate feedback, helping users understand that their action was successful.
Increase interactivity, creating a more engaging experience.
Guide users through a step-by-step interaction, such as filling out a form.
Hover Effects
Hover effects activate when a user hovers over an element with the cursor. The element changes color, shape, or position, indicating that itβs interactive. Hover effects make websites more intuitive by showing which elements are clickable or can be explored further. These effects are especially common for menus and links to aid navigation and visually support the user.
Benefits of Hover Effects:
Enhance usability by highlighting interactive elements.
Provide visual feedback for the user.
Particularly effective for menus, buttons, and image galleries, where navigation is key.
Loading Animations
Loading animations appear while the website or specific content loads, offering visual feedback to reassure users that the page is active and loading. Loading animations help reduce perceived wait times, improving user satisfaction. Theyβre particularly important on data-heavy websites, like e-commerce sites or content platforms.
Benefits of Loading Animations:
Minimize perceived wait time and boost user patience.
Improve the user experience through clear communication.
Make waiting more pleasant and less disruptive with engaging visuals, like rotating icons or progress indicators.
Transition Animations
Transition animations create a smooth flow between different pages or sections, adding a cohesive, harmonious touch to the design. These effects help optimize user navigation and guide users when moving between areas of the site. Transition animations are especially helpful on mobile devices, where they facilitate navigation and make movement between sections feel seamless.
Benefits of Transition Animations:
Ease transitions between pages for a cohesive experience.
Enhance navigation and aid orientation, especially for apps and mobile sites.
Prevent abrupt changes, ensuring a smooth design that enhances the user journey.
Best Practices for Using Scroll Effects and Animations
Thoughtful use of scroll effects and animations can enhance user interaction and the overall experience. However, there are a few established strategies to ensure animations serve their purpose without overwhelming the interface or affecting performance. Here are the most important aspects for effective implementation.
User-Centric Design: Matching Effects to Content
Animations and scroll effects should always complement the content and purpose of the site, rather than distracting from them. A user-centric approach puts the needs and expectations of the audience first. A well-integrated animation directs attention to key content and simplifies navigation without overwhelming the user experience.
An example of this is subtle transition animations between page changes or scroll elements that present information progressively. This approach enhances the user experience while remaining unobtrusive.
Performance Optimization: Efficiently Designed Effects
An excessive number of animations can slow down website load times, especially on mobile devices. Itβs essential to design animations and effects to avoid impacting site performance.
One way to achieve this is by limiting effects to only whatβs necessary and focusing them on areas that truly benefit from movement. Using technologies like CSS animations and lazy loading for images helps optimize performance and keep load times short.
Mobile Compatibility: Adapting to Different Devices
Since more and more users access websites on mobile devices, scroll effects and animations must work seamlessly on smaller screens. Animations should adjust to screen size and user interaction, as large or complex effects can disrupt scrolling on mobile.
A mobile-optimized approach might involve turning off certain animations on mobile devices or replacing them with simplified versions, keeping the design user-friendly and visually appealing across all devices.
Minimal Use: Striking the Right Balance
Too many animations can feel overwhelming and distract from the main content. The key is a balanced use of effects that enrich the experience without dominating the design. A targeted approach that highlights only essential elements keeps the design clean and professional, aiding content comprehension.
In summary: Animations should primarily serve a functional purpose, supporting the design without overloading the page or extending load times. Thoughtful implementation and attention to performance and mobile compatibility are key to creating a well-rounded user experience.
Tools and Technologies for Scroll Effects and Animations
To efficiently implement modern scroll effects and animations, web designers have a wide range of tools and technologies available. The choice of tool largely depends on technical expertise, project scale, and specific site requirements. Here are some of the most popular tools and technologies, useful for both beginners and professionals.
JavaScript Libraries: Flexibility and Control
JavaScript libraries offer high flexibility when creating animations and scroll effects. GreenSock Animation Platform (GSAP) is one of the most powerful and popular libraries, providing extensive animation options without compromising performance. It allows for complex effects like dynamic parallax scrolling or custom animations that respond to user actions. If you're considering starting a project in this field, a JavaScript development company can provide the expertise and support you need.
ScrollMagic is another JavaScript library designed specifically for scroll effects. It enables animations to be tied directly to the scrolling process, which is particularly useful for interactive storytelling websites. For designers who want full control over their effects, JavaScript libraries provide a flexible and robust solution.
No-Code Tools: Animation Without Coding Knowledge
No-code tools allow designers to create animations without writing a single line of code. Webflow is one such tool thatβs growing in popularity. With Webflow, designers can create custom animations and scroll effects directly in a visual interface. The platform is especially suitable for small to medium-sized projects where integration into existing websites needs to be quick and straightforward. For anyone looking to enter this sector, a Webflow development company is the ideal partner to successfully bring your project to life.
Another practical tool is Framer, which not only supports animation but also helps create interactive prototypes. Framer provides an intuitive interface and enables motion animations that respond to user actions, making it a valuable resource for designers focused on user experience and interactivity.
CSS Animations: Simple and Performant
For simpler animations, such as hover effects or basic transitions, CSS animations are ideal. CSS is lightweight and integrates directly into the web browser, providing high performance and minimal load times. CSS is perfect for micro-interactions and fundamental animations that enhance the design without consuming additional resources.
An example of CSS animations is hover effects or basic fade-in and slide-in animations that visually elevate a page without requiring extensive coding. Animate.css is a useful library with pre-built CSS animations, making it easy to add these effects to any project and speeding up implementation.
Conclusion: The Value of Scroll Effects and Animations in Modern Web Design
Scroll effects and animations have become essential elements for enhancing the user experience. Well-designed animations and movements help draw users' attention, improve usability, and strengthen brand identity. From parallax scrolling to micro-interactions to loading animations, every type of movement can be strategically applied to enhance interactivity and usability on a website.
However, despite the variety of options, animations should always be applied thoughtfully and sparingly. Overuse can lead to performance issues and overwhelm users. The best scroll effects and animations are those that subtly but effectively support navigation and orientation, creating a harmonious design.
Choosing the right tools and technologies enables designers to achieve impressive effects without compromising load time or mobile compatibility. JavaScript libraries are perfect for complex projects, no-code tools are great for visual designers, and CSS is ideal for simpler, resource-efficient effects.
Ultimately, itβs clear that animations will continue to play an increasingly vital role in web design. They allow designers to create a dynamic user experience that is not only visually appealing but also functional and user-friendly. A balanced use of scroll effects and animations can enrich web design and provide users with a memorable experience.
FAQs
They enhance the user experience, direct attention effectively, and make content more understandable and engaging.
Movement captures attention, helping to highlight key content and increase user interest.
Unique animations and motion patterns create a distinctive brand experience that fosters recognition and trust.
They make interactive elements more visible and navigation more intuitive, especially on smaller screens.
Targeted animations draw attention to call-to-action elements, boosting interaction and completion rates.
Parallax scrolling creates a sense of depth, often used on storytelling sites to immerse users in the content.
Reveal effects focus attention on specific content and present information step-by-step, aiding comprehension.
Platforms with continuous content, like social media or e-commerce, as it provides a seamless user experience.
Lazy loading improves load times and reduces data usage, which is especially beneficial on mobile devices.